Lawrenceburg Girls Soccer Wins Team of the Year Award

The Tigers were recognized at the Cincinnati Enquirer High School Sports Awards on Wednesday.

(Left to right): Morgan Manford, Kelsey Offutt, Aubree LaBazzo, and Preslee Rugg accept the Girls Team of the Year Award. Photo provided.

CINCINNATI - The state championship-winning Lawrenceburg Tigers were once again recognized on Wednesday night. 

Lawrenceburg girls soccer won Girls Team of the Year at the Cincinnati Enquirer High School Awards ceremony. Other nominees were Badin flag football; Madeira girls soccer; Purcell Marian girls basketball and Seton volleyball.

Captains Kelsey Offutt, Morgan Manford, and Preslee Rugg, along with Aubree LaBazzo accepted the award.

LaBazzo was also nominated for NKY/Indiana Soccer Player of the Year. As a junior, she was named Third Team All-State after helping anchor a Tigers' defense that surrendered only seven goals in 22 matches.

Lawrenceburg went 21-1 last fall, capturing their first state championship in program history by defeating Mishawaka Marian 4-1 in penalty kicks.
